How much does it cost to rent an apartment in The University of Texas at Austin?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| The University of Texas at Austin Studio Apartments | $1,102 | $800 | $1,405 |
| The University of Texas at Austin 1 Bedroom Apartments | $969 | $900 | $1,145 |
| The University of Texas at Austin 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,444 | $799 | $2,500 |
| The University of Texas at Austin 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,075 | $2,075 | $2,075 |

Frequently Asked Questions about The University of Texas at Austin
What is the current price range for One Bedroom The University of Texas at Austin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in The University of Texas at Austin ranges from $900 to $1,145 with an average monthly rent of $969.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in The University of Texas at Austin c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in The University of Texas at Austin range from $799 to $2,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,444.
